Cisco has addressed a denial of service (DoS) vulnerability, listed under the identifier CVE-2025-20115, which allows an unauthenticated, remote attacker to crash the Border Gateway Protocol (BGP) process on IOS XR routers. This flaw can be exploited by sending a single malicious BGP packet. The impact of this vulnerability is the disruption of the BGP process, which can lead to service interruptions on networks using these routers.
